{"object":[{"sourceId":{"label":"Source ID","value":"31375"},"creditline":{"label":"Credit Line","value":"The Sixth Floor Museum at Dealey Plaza Collection"},"labelText":{"label":"Description","value":"Original White House press release of an Executive Order issued by the Kennedy Administration, dated September 30, 1962.  It instructs the Secretary of Defense to \"take all appropriate steps\" to remove obstructions of justice in Mississippi.\r\n\r\nPress release is a double-sided, one-page document. Heading at top of document reads:\r\n\r\n\r\n\" IMMEDIATE RELEASE              SEPTEMBER 30, 1962\r\nOffice of the White House Press Secretary\r\n-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-\r\nTHE WHITE HOUSE\r\nEXECUTIVE ORDER\r\n\r\nPROVIDING ASSISTANCE FOR THE REMOVAL OF UNLAWFUL OBSTRUCTIONS OF JUSTICE IN THE STATE OF MISSISSIPPI \"\r\n\r\nFull text of the Executive Order follows, giving the Secretary of Defense the authorization to enforce orders of the U.S. District Court and to use the military to remove all obstructions of justice in the State of Mississippi."},"invno":{"label":"Object number","value":"2010.042.0002"},"description":{"label":"Description","value":"One original press release issued by the Kennedy Administration, dated 30 September 1962.
